How to Define the Assumptions to Validate

Basically, assumptions are defined as the actions and steps which are very critical for your business, but at this stage, we don’t know that they take care of these steps. For Example, Airbnb considers some of the assumptions which are necessary for their product to initiate them.

To give them the true experience the travelers must visit the city that not the hotel that disconnects them from the city. The Rent of the hotels is very expensive for the average customer if there is no other option. Also, there’s must be another option which the customers can avail themselves instead of the hotel. Like the Neighbour’s house and other places which are least expensive than the hotels.

In that way, the house owners also feel pleasant to open their houses for passengers to earn some extra income.

In that way, you must list your cons or assumption which the Airbnb company lIsted above. Once you’ve listed all the points of assumption then it’s time to take action on those points and solve them which can be easily solved by doing the research.

Then you have a handful of assumptions that can be solved by building an app. Now you have the Final step to level up this MVP process game is rebuilding.

  • ReBuild the List of Assumptions and Solve them:

Now in this rebuilding process, you must have to list all the features which you think your product must-have from the starting to the end.

After that, you have to put these features list in the list of assumptions that you prepared previously.

For Every Feature, you must have to ask yourself that is this feature is necessary to show them in the MVP with one assumption. If necessary then add them to the MVP list and if not then highlight that thing with the label “Nice to have” which can be considered in the future.

Once you’ve compared all of the features you want with the assumptions you need to prove you’ll have taken into account all the product considerations you need to build a truly lean MVP.
